Evaluation of the effect of cooperative infrastructure-to-vehicle systems on driver behavior

摘要

In-vehicle technologies and co-operative services have potential to ease congestion prob lems and improve traffic safety. This paper investigates the impact of infrastructure-to-vehicle co-operative systems, case of CO-OPerative SystEms for Intelligent Road Safety (COOPERS), on driver behavior. Thirty-five test drivers drove an instrumented vehicle, twice, with and without the system. Data related to driving behavior, physiological mea surements, and user acceptance was collected. A macro-level approach was used to evalu ate the potential impact of such systems on driver behavior and traffic safety. The results in terms of speeds, following gaps, and physiological measurements indicate a positive impact. Furthermore, drivers' opinions show that the system is in general acceptable and useful.
